1What is the typical cost for professional carpet cleaning in Cordesville, and what factors influence the price?

In the Cordesville and greater Berkeley County area, most reputable companies charge by the square foot, typically ranging from $0.25 to $0.50 per square foot. The final cost is influenced by the carpet's soil level, the need for stain pre-treatment, furniture moving, and the specific cleaning method (e.g., hot water extraction vs. dry cleaning). Given our local humidity, heavily soiled carpets may require more intensive treatment, which can affect pricing.

2How does South Carolina's humid climate affect carpet cleaning and drying times?

Cordesville's high humidity, especially from late spring through early fall, can significantly extend carpet drying times after a deep clean. While professional-grade equipment extracts most moisture, we recommend scheduling cleanings during drier periods when possible and using air conditioning or fans to circulate air. Proper drying is critical to prevent mold and mildew growth, which is a common concern in our coastal Southern climate.

3Are there any local regulations or best practices for wastewater disposal from carpet cleaning in Berkeley County?

Yes, environmental responsibility is important. In Berkeley County, it is illegal and harmful to discharge wastewater containing cleaning chemicals, soil, and dyes directly into storm drains, septic systems, or onto the ground. Reputable Cordesville-area cleaners will follow best practices by containing and disposing of this wastewater properly, often using a dedicated drain or approved disposal method to protect our local waterways and groundwater.

4What should I look for when choosing a reliable carpet cleaning service in the Cordesville area?

Prioritize local, insured companies with verifiable references from nearby residents. Ask about their specific experience with common local issues like red clay stains, sand, and humidity-related odors. A trustworthy provider will offer a clear, in-person or detailed virtual estimate, explain their cleaning process, and should be certified by a recognized body like the Institute of Inspection, Cleaning and Restoration Certification (IICRC).

5What is the best time of year to get carpets cleaned in Cordesville, and how often should it be done?

The ideal times are during our milder, drier periods in late fall (October-November) and early spring (March-April), when windows can be opened to aid drying. For most households, an annual professional cleaning is recommended. However, homes with pets, high foot traffic, or residents with allergies may benefit from cleaning every 6-9 months to manage the pollen, dust, and moisture prevalent in our region.
